Output 1566248e0a971bafc6203991fba87a011839b15c535d69f8db26e9fbbd465292:1

value
668722837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45777d68cb2bce212e52ec0a040f60ebde11f645 OP_EQUAL
address
382Kh5jj9VNs2h3G5yuExceRNhwMLacBNU
transaction
1566248e0a971bafc6203991fba87a011839b15c535d69f8db26e9fbbd465292
spent
true